TesisCarmen
Principal ] Arriba ]

Asignación de conductores a jornadas de trabajo en empresas de transporte colectivo

La asignación de los conductores es la cuarta y última fase de las cuatro etapas en que se suele dividir el complejo problema de la organización de servicios en una empresa de transporte terrestre regular.

Se encuadra dentro de lo que se conoce como problema de rostering ya que se concreta en la elaboración de turnos de trabajo rotativo.

Así como las tres etapas que preceden al rostering son problemas ampliamente estudiados y mecanizados en la mayor parte de las grandes compañías de trasporte, el problema de rostering plantea peculiaridades debidas a los usos de cada país y a los convenios laborales de cada empresa que hace prácticamente imposible una solución universal.

La tesis presenta un acercamiento a los requisitos impuestos en algunas de las principales compañías españolas y ratifica este hecho mediante la constatación de que existen restricciones no sólo distintas sino contradictorias entre compañías.

En muchos casos las restricciones impuestas son fruto de unos derechos adquiridos históricamente y en consecuencia difíciles de cambiar, cabe no obstante preguntarse si es posible mejorar la asignación que se está haciendo actualmente sin violar ninguno de los requisitos impuestos. Como respuesta, el presente trabajo plantea el cómo mejorar una situación concreta, para ello elabora un procedimiento que apoyado en técnicas de programación lineal y una heurística greedy mejora la actual asignación notablemente.

Por último plantea un problema genérico donde sólo se imponen criterios de equidad en el sentido de tratar de buscar aquellas soluciones que mejor repartan la carga de trabajo y los días libres. Para resolverlo aporta un nuevo procedimiento que se divide en dos fases: construcción de patrones y construcción de listas de tareas.

En la construcción de los patrones se exige que estos sean de ciclo corto, lo cual lleva a la innovación de un procedimiento que concretado en dos estrategias alternativas modifica de forma dinámica un programa lineal entero y va presentando las distintas soluciones o patrones de ciclo corto que cubren perfectamente la demanda de conductores solicitada.

La elaboración de listas de tareas se aborda y resuelve satisfactoriamente mediante una heurística GRASP, la cual plantea una secuencia de programas lineales mixtos que dan la cota inferior de las asignaciones planteadas, con dicha información se van construyendo las distintas soluciones a partir de las cuales, posteriormente se lleva a cabo la búsqueda local.

Se han procesado ejemplos con datos reales facilitados por algunas compañías y los resultados obtenidos reducen espectacularmente el desequilibrio observado en la carga laboral actual entre conductores.

 

Rostering Problem in public transport companies

The complex problem of assigning duties to public transport drivers is the fourth and last phase in which the problem is usually divided.

It is a scheduling problem well known in the business world, due to the fact that crews work in rotating shifts.

The three phases that precede the above mentioned problem are widely studied and mechanized by the majority of the large transport companies. However, the rostering problem is complicated by each country's use of this phase and to the labour agreements of each company. It makes a universal solution practically impossible.

This thesis presents an approach to the requirements imposed by some of the main Spanish companies. It confirms this fact by establishing that distinct and contradictory restrictions exist among companies.

In many cases the imposed restrictions are the result of historically acquired rights and are difficult to change. Nevertheless, it is feasible to improve the assignment without violating any of the imposed requirements. In short the present thesis raises the question of how to improve the situation. It details a procedure that is supported in lineal programming techniques and a greedy heuristic.

Finally the thesis presents a general problem where only criteria of equity are imposed in the sense of seeking solutions that better distribute the workload and the days-off. Seeking to solve the problem has led to a new procedure that is divided into two phases: constructions of patterns and roster construction.

The construction of the patterns requires short cycles, leading to an innovation that summarizes two alternative strategies that dynamically modify an Integer lineal program and displays the different solutions, or short cycle patterns that cover perfectly the drivers' demands.

The roster elaboration is approached and solved satisfactorily by means of a GRASP algorithm, which raises a mixed lineal programs sequence that give the lower band of the assignments presented. With this information one arrives at different solutions from which the local search is carried out.

Examples with real data have been processed, the data coming from existing companies. The results spectacularly reduce the differences observed in the present driver workload distribution.

(La tesis completa está publicada en http://www.tdcat.cesca.es/TDCat-1022101-084109/ )